Output 19f89ceabbc21fea619bb0a0b0769ae2e04f9e63d30edb6d59b0ad43d625b356:1

value
10173736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f3f941c948cde2b72db986a10fb08b25b0dd71 OP_EQUAL
address
3DY9MspMEY9BBJg2vQQHP5LfYFTpR1nhgM
transaction
19f89ceabbc21fea619bb0a0b0769ae2e04f9e63d30edb6d59b0ad43d625b356
spent
true